From: Fucoidan prevent murine autoimmune diabetes via suppression TLR4-signaling pathways, regulation DC/Treg induced immune tolerance and improving gut microecology

Fig. 3

Effects of fucoidan on Foxp3 expression in spleen and DC phenotype in NOD mice. a Western Blot analysis of Foxp3 expression in spleen. Fucoidan intervention up-regulated spleen Foxp3 levels. b Effect of fucoidan on DC phenotype in NOD mice. Flow cytometry was used to analyze the expression of MHC-II and costimulatory molecule CD86 on DC surface. The expressions of MHC II and CD86 in CD11c + DCs in the 12-week-old NOD mice in the fucoidan intervention group was significantly lower than those in the control group. Especially in the high-dose fucoidan group, the effect was more pronounced.
